Title :
Research on Neutral-point Balancing Control for Three-level NPC Inverter Based on Correlation between Carrier-based PWM and SVPWM

Abstract :
Based on inherent correlation between the carrier-based PWM and SVPWM for three-level inverter, this paper presents a new modulation approach for the control of the neutral-point voltage variation in the three-level neutral-point-clamped voltage source inverter. The new modulation approach realizes the control of inverter neutral-point current by modifying redundant small vectors pairs distribution factor, only requiring the information of dc-link capacitor voltages and three-phase load currents, which is convenient to apply and is compatible of digital computer realization. The effectiveness of proposed control approach is verified by simulation and experiment results
